| | Re: Unwanted redirects to "Spritted" game website (an EF/AdSense ad bug)
This does indeed seem to be coming either via Google AdSense or another third-party ad network.
I think it's benign, but running your browser with uBlock or similar will prevent it.

| | Re: Unwanted redirects to "Spritted" game website (an EF/AdSense ad bug)
I've noticed the same today, from Chrome on Windows 7 and Safari on iOS 8.
I've also observed that when this issue happens:
* it's always when I first load the landing page from a new browser session
* the fonts appear slightly different - as in, I think the landing page is actually using a different font or different font size
* clicking any link makes it happen
* in testing just now, an anonymous (not logged in) session from IE did not trigger it, though I don't know if that's a one-off or not.
